GREENVILLE, Pa. – The Thiel College women's volleyball team dropped a four set decision (13-25, 22-25, 25-22, 23-25) to Presidents' Athletic Conference (PAC) rival Grove City Thursday night inside Beeghly Gymnasium.
Five Tomcats collected more than five kills in the match, led by Senior
Hannah Budzowski (New Castle, Pa./Shenango). Budzowski had a team-high seven kills, along with four block assists.
Danielle Gomula (Northfield, Ohio/Trinity) and
Peyton Allen (Mineral Ridge, Ohio/Mineral Ridge) each collected six kills respectively while
Shelby Friedel (Columbia Station, Ohio/Columbia) and
Jenny Shelley (Port Allegany, Pa./Port Allegany) knocked down five kills.
Shelley also notched her third double-double of the season in the loss with 22 assists and 14 digs. Defensively,
Ashley Baer (Cambridge Springs, Pa./Cambridge Springs) led the Tomcat defense with 26 digs. Allen added 19 digs on defense.
Laura Buchanan had a match-high 13 kills for the Wolverines.
